Output 52d5249f618821ecb2ea8343833eb8cc23149e5e7ee37f476f13db73ff5fc3e1:6

value
9558653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 470eb2eddfd75bfe04a3d1c2c9219b6f8af48c0f OP_EQUALVERIFY OP_CHECKSIG
address
17UiavP7bCp4jJZSPhwVZKW51ihuzFxQ93
transaction
52d5249f618821ecb2ea8343833eb8cc23149e5e7ee37f476f13db73ff5fc3e1
spent
true